# 10. Thressa D Young v. Blue Sky Capital Realty Inc, et al.

Case No.: 20CMCV00158

Matter on calendar for: demurrer to First Amended Complaint

Tentative ruling:

Facts

In this wrongful foreclosure action, plaintiff Thressa Young (“Young”) alleges defendants Blue Sky Capital Realty, Inc., dba Elite Loan Servicing, Metro Capital Fund, LLC (“MCF”), and S.B.S. Trust Deed Network (“S.B.S”) violated multiple provisions of the Homeowners Bill of Rights (“HBOR”). Young acquired a $29,586.97 Home Equity Credit Line Revolving Loan Agreement in 2007 from Residential Capital Mortgage Income Fund, LLC, secured by a deed of trust on 929 W. Myrrh Street, Compton, California 90220. On February 22, 2013, the deed of trust was assigned to MCF. On March 31, 2020, S.B.S. was substituted in as trustee. A notice of default and election to sell were recorded the same day. The Complaint was filed on June 23, 2020. A notice of trustee’s sale was recorded on July 16, 2020.
